/**
* Converts std::chrono:duration from given unit to other where other duration
* is no less than the given duration.
*
* For internal use only.
*/
template <class ToDuration, class Rep, class Period>
inline
typename std::enable_if<_is_duration<ToDuration>::value, ToDuration>::type
_ceil(const std::chrono::duration<Rep, Period>& duration) {
ToDuration other = std::chrono::duration_cast<ToDuration>(duration);
if (other < duration) {
return other + ToDuration{1};
}
return other;
}
/**
* Parses std::string into std::chrono::duration expecting same format as that
* of C++14 std::chrono::duration literals.
*
* @returns std::chrono::duration for given input string where the resulting
* std::chrono::duration will not be less than the parsed duration if the
* units of std::chrono::duration are less the units of the given string.
*
* @tparam ToDuration std::chrono::duration type to parse into.
*/
template <class ToDuration = std::chrono::nanoseconds>
inline
typename std::enable_if<_is_duration<ToDuration>::value, ToDuration>::type
from_string(const std::string& string) {
const auto& begin = string.begin();
auto end = string.end();
if (begin != end--) {
if ('s' == *end) {
if (begin != end--) {
if ('m' == *end) {
return _ceil<ToDuration>(std::chrono::milliseconds(
std::stoll(string.substr(0, std::distance(begin, end)))));
} else if ('u' == *end) {
return _ceil<ToDuration>(std::chrono::microseconds(
std::stoll(string.substr(0, std::distance(begin, end)))));
} else if ('n' == *end) {
return _ceil<ToDuration>(std::chrono::nanoseconds(
std::stoll(string.substr(0, std::distance(begin, end)))));
}
}
return _ceil<ToDuration>(std::chrono::seconds(
std::stoll(string.substr(0, std::distance(begin, ++end)))));
} else if ('h' == *end) {
return std::chrono::hours(
std::stoll(string.substr(0, std::distance(begin, end))));
} else if ('n' == *end && begin != end-- && 'i' == *end && begin != end-- &&
'm' == *end) {
return _ceil<ToDuration>(std::chrono::minutes(
std::stoll(string.substr(0, std::distance(begin, end)))));
}
}
throw std::invalid_argument("Not a valid duration parsing '" + string + "'.");
}
template <class Rep, class Period>
inline std::string to_string(
const std::chrono::duration<Rep, Period>& duration) {
return std::to_string(duration.count()) + _suffix<Period>::value;
}
